Summary

Luka Doncic expressed excitement about the Los Angeles Lakers’ offseason moves, including their decision to retain Austin Reaves and sign center Walker Kessler. The Lakers undertook significant changes after LeBron James indicated he would leave the team. Doncic, currently in Europe, has maintained communication with the Lakers regarding their roster adjustments, which also include new players Quentin Grimes, Sandro Mamukelashvili, and Collin Sexton. The Lakers aimed to address key needs in their lineup following the loss of three rotation players.
